Immunofluorescence
Application

Immunofluorescence

The CCF-STTG1 cell line was fixed with 5% Acetic acid Methanol solution for 30 minutes followed by 5% Bovine serum PBS blocking , cells are permeabilized by 0.1% Triton X PBS for 15 mines before and stained with GFAP monoclonal antibody, clone SB61b (Cat # MAB3336) and then cells were fixed. (The cell washing buffer was 0.15% tween 20 in PBS.) Finally the slide was mounted with Fluormount-G contained DAPI.

    Gene Summary

    This gene encodes one of the major intermediate filament proteins of mature astrocytes. It is used as a marker to distinguish astrocytes from other glial cells during development. Mutations in this gene cause Alexander disease, a rare disorder of astrocytes in the central nervous system. Alternative splicing results in multiple transcript variants encoding distinct isoforms.
